When I connect WD My Passport Ultra hard drive to laptop, my computer page keeps on loading without ever completely loading to give the storage information on the external drive. Sometimes, windows explorer page freezes and the drive, not even it’s name loads. I have important information on the drive and don’t want to lose it. Please suggest how to solve this issue.
Solutions tried:
-
Checked the Windows Disk Management, and the information is not loaded here as well
-
Tried with friend’s laptops with different OS varying from Windows 7 to Windows 10. Not loaded in any of them.
Laptop: Asus P50IJ
OS: Windows 10
Hard Disk: My Passport Ultra 1 TB

Did you try changing the USB cable as well? If so, then it may be an early sign of disk drive failure. I’d advise against further drive usage in order to minimize unit harm while you proceed to contact a specialized data recovery service company.
